About Healix Health
Founded in 2000 by two clinicians, Healix Health was built on the belief that healthcare works best when it’s personal, not prescriptive. We are a leading UK corporate healthcare consultancy, partnering with Employee Benefit Consultancies (EBCs), HR, Finance and Reward leaders to design, fund and govern sustainable employee healthcare strategies. We specialise in self‑funded healthcare trusts and clinically led claims management, helping organisations rethink healthcare structure, funding and delivery, aligning employee wellbeing with commercial, workforce and financial objectives.
About The Role
We’re looking for an enthusiastic and motivated Junior Account Manager to join our Third Party Administration (TPA) team. This is a fantastic development opportunity for someone keen to build expertise, strengthen client‑facing skills and progress into a confident, independent Account Manager role. Working closely with experienced colleagues, you’ll support a portfolio of TPA clients and help deliver exceptional service to insurer, broker and corporate partners.
What You’ll Be Doing
- Support the day‑to‑day management of TPA client accounts under the guidance of senior account managers
- Act as a first point of contact for client queries, ensuring timely, accurate and professional responses
- Assist with preparing client reports, service reviews and performance updates
- Build strong working relationships with clients, internal teams and external providers
- Work closely with claims, membership, clinical operations and customer service teams to support smooth service delivery
- Monitor service levels and elevate risks or issues appropriately
- Support the onboarding of new clients, coordinating requirements and implementation activities
- Assist in producing KPIs, MI dashboards and client performance summaries
- Help identify trends, service improvements and opportunities to add value
- Maintain accurate records, documentation and contract information
- Contribute to process reviews and service improvements
- Take part in projects aimed at enhancing our TPA offering
- Actively develop knowledge of Private Medical Insurance (PMI) and UK healthcare funding; TPA operational workflows and claims management; regulatory requirements (including FCA and data protection)
- Learn through feedback, shadowing and close collaboration within a supportive team environment
